What companies run services between London Euston, England and Dean Street / Chinatown, England?

London Underground (Tube) operates a subway from Euston station to Leicester Square station every 5 minutes. Tickets cost £1–5 and the journey takes 5 min. Alternatively, Abellio London operates a bus from Warren Street Station / Euston Road to Cambridge Circus every 10 minutes. Tickets cost £2 and the journey takes 9 min. Three other operators also service this route.
